Provides advanced level production support of web applications. Directs and coordinates technical procedures to resolve production issues after evaluation. Primarily focused on B2B and D2C applications. Proficient in use of industry standard tools. e.g. Splunk, AWS Cloudwatch, Honeycomb, Service Now
Leads the monitoring of production systems for alerts, outages, and system issues. Researches issues and performs root cause analysis to minimize risk. Manages the expectations and requirements of business and production support teams.
Understands service level agreements and ensures that support requests are resolved within the service level agreement timeframe. Resolves elevated issues and communicates the resolutions.
Writes and updates production support documentation, policies, and procedures.
Leads improvement efforts and directs changes.
Operates as an advanced technical partner and maintains strong working relationships with development, AWS cloudOps and business partners.
Mentors and trains junior production support analysts. Proactively expands knowledge of systems and shares best practices.
Participates in special projects and performs other duties as assigned.
Qualifications
Minimum of five years related work experience, with two years of IT operational experience.
Undergraduate degree or equivalent combination of training and experience. Degree in Computer Science or Management Information Systems preferred.
Solid understanding of ITIL practices (Incident, Request, Change & Problem).
Good knowledge of AWS service. Any AWS certification is a plus.
Understand web server interactions, backend microservices, web API gateways. Have scripting experience is a plus.
Experience of monitoring and logging tools such as Splunk, Honeycomb, Cloudwawtch and AWS X-ray
